Datediff with lag sql

WebJan 9, 2024 · Using PySpark SQL functions datediff(), months_between() you can calculate the difference between two dates in days, months, and year, let’s see this by using a DataFrame example. You can also use these to calculate age. datediff() Function. First Let’s see getting the difference between two dates using datediff() PySpark function. WebFeb 20, 2024 · DATEDIFF() in SQL. The DATEDIFF() function compares two dates and returns the difference. The DATEDIFF() function is specifically used to measure the …

datediff function - Azure Databricks - Databricks SQL Microsoft …

Web您应该肯定会期望某种涉及日期时间数据的SQL问题。 例如,您可能需要将数据分组组或将可变格式从DD-MM-Yyyy转换为简单的月份。 您应该知道的一些功能是: 提炼 日元 date_add,date_sub. date_trunc. 示例问题:给定天气表,写一个SQL查询,以查找与其上一个(昨天)日期相比的温度较高的所有日期的ID。 WebMar 6, 2024 · 如果你想要在 PostgreSQL 中查询某一列中最大日期对应的另一列数据,可以使用以下 SQL 语句: SELECT column2 FROM table_name WHERE date_column = (SELECT MAX (date_column) FROM table_name); 其中 column2 是你想要查询的另一列的名称, table_name 是你的表的名称, date_column 是你的日期列的名称。 注意:在上 … fling on the side https://pulsprice.com

LAG (Transact-SQL) - SQL Server Microsoft Learn

Webpyspark.sql.functions.datediff ¶ pyspark.sql.functions.datediff(end: ColumnOrName, start: ColumnOrName) → pyspark.sql.column.Column [source] ¶ Returns the number of days … WebDec 29, 2024 · Use DATEDIFF_BIG in the SELECT , WHERE, HAVING, GROUP BY and ORDER BY clauses. DATEDIFF_BIG implicitly casts string literals as a datetime2 … WebOct 15, 2014 · SELECT *, ISNULL(DATEDIFF(mi, LAG(CreateDate,1) OVER (ORDER BY ID), CreateDate), 0) AS Duration. FROM MyTable. MSDN LAG reference. Edit: To refine … fling others

Calculate the difference between rows using LAG ()

Category:Calculate the difference between rows using LAG ()

Tags:Datediff with lag sql

Datediff with lag sql

Calculate the difference between rows using LAG ()

WebOct 7, 2024 · User-595703101 posted. Hello Sellal, Please check following SQL Select statement for calculating periodicity of the array as you defined;with cte as ( select ROW_NUMBER() over (order by value) rn, COUNT(*) over (partition by 1) cnt, id, value from StatisticalNumbers ), median as ( select id, rn, cnt, value, case when (cnt % 2 = 1) then … Webcontains sql: 表示子程序包含 sql 语句,但不包含读或写数据的语句。 2. no sql: 表示子程序中不包含 sql 语句。 3. reads sql data: 表示子程序中包含读数据的语句。 4. modifies …

Datediff with lag sql

Did you know?

WebAug 30, 2024 · OR t1.AttendanceDatetimeIN = LAG(t1.AttendanceDatetimeIN) OVER (ORDER BY t1.employeeCode)) AND DATEDIFF(MINUTE, ISNULL(LAG(t1.AttendanceDatetimeOUT) OVER (ORDER BY t1.EmployeeCode),... WebApr 20, 2011 · As @a_horse_with_no_name mentioned using the lag () I wanted in millisecond what the diff was. Select idcode, datetime, Difference = datediff (millisecond, …

WebAug 18, 2024 · This question is similar to SQL Server LAG () function to calculate differences between rows, except that that example uses DATEDIFF (). Suppose I have … WebSQL LAG() is a window function that provides access to a row at a specified physical offset which comes before the current row. In other words, by using the LAG() function, from …

WebLearn how to use The SQL Server DATEDIFF() Function to return the difference between two dates. Websql google-analytics bigdata google-bigquery. 2. Tyler 13 Июл 2015 в 20:59. ... используя DATEDIFF с фиксированной базой, а затем использовать функцию LAG для поиска значений, следующий запрос показывает пример этого подхода: ...

WebMar 9, 2024 · 在 SQL Server 中,如果您想要查询多个数据库中的销售客户的销售合计,您可以使用下面的 SQL 语句: ``` SELECT SUM(sales) FROM [database_name].[schema_name].[table_name] WHERE customer_type = 'sales'; ``` 其中,`database_name` 是数据库的名称,`schema_name` 是表所属的模式的名 …

Web目前我正在嘗試將日期表連接到分類帳表,以便在某些情況下沒有交易時可以填補分類帳表的空白 例如, 月 日和 月 日有交易,但 月沒有交易 nd。通過加入兩個表, 月 日將出現在分類帳表中,但我們正在分析的變量為 。 挑戰是我無法創建 Date 對象 表 維度,因為我沒有在數據庫中創建表的權限。 fling outriders trainerWebCode language: SQL (Structured Query Language) (sql) The PARTITION BY clause divides the rows of the result sets into partitions to which the LAST_VALUE() function applies. … fling out crossword clueWebMay 12, 2015 · This can be achieved very easily with the LAG() window function: SELECT ts, ts - lag(ts, 1) OVER (ORDER BY ts) delta FROM timestamps ORDER BY ts; ... Window functions are extremely powerful and they’re a part of the SQL standard, supported in most commercial databases, in PostgreSQL, in Firebird 3.0, and in CUBRID. If you aren’t … fling out the anti-slavery flag analysisWebAug 6, 2013 · You could do it the following way. SELECT DAYS_BETWEEN (TO_DATE ('2009-12-05', 'YYYY-MM-DD'), TO_DATE ('2010-01-05', 'YYYY-MM-DD')) "days … fling out meaningWebJan 19, 2015 · -- DateDiff( day, Previous End Date, Current Start Date) AS DiffDays /* LAG (scalar_expression [,offset] [,default]) OVER ( [ partition_by_clause ] order_by_clause ) */ … greater frequency meansWebAug 25, 2011 · The DATEDIFF() function returns the difference between two dates. Syntax. DATEDIFF(interval, date1, date2) Parameter Values. Parameter Description; interval: … greater fremont development councilWebJul 18, 2014 · You can use the Lag function if you are on SQL Server 2012+ CREATE TABLE #Temp (SN INT, MyDay DATE, Class INT) INSERT INTO #Temp VALUES (1,'1/1/2014',1), (1,'1/2/2014',2), (3,'1/7/2014',1), (4,'1/14/2014',1), (5,'1/24/2014',3) SELECT *, DATEDIFF(D,LAG(MyDay) OVER (ORDER BY SN),MyDay) AS Diff FROM #Temp … fling pastebin script